开发环境优化实践 —— 面向零基础初学者的完整教程
开篇:什么是“开发环境”?为什么我们要优化它?

在你正式开始学习编程之前,先来理解一个重要的概念:开发环境。
什么是一个“开发环境”?
简单来说,开发环境就是程序员用来写代码、调试程序、测试功能的一整套工具和配置。就像是厨师的厨房、画家的工作室一样,它是你进行编程工作的“场所”。
一个良好的开发环境能让你:
- 写代码更快、更高效;
- 看清代码结构,不容易出错;
- 快速测试你的程序是否运行正常;
- 更容易发现和解决错误(也就是常说的“Debug”);
- 让你和其他人合作时更顺畅。
而开发环境优化,就是在这些方面做得更好。
我们今天的目标是:用最简单的语言,从零开始帮助你搭建并优化自己的第一个开发环境!
第一步:环境准备 —— 搭建属于你的“开发厨房”


本节我们将使用最常见的编程语言之一——Python作为示例,因为它语法简洁、适合初学者,并且广泛应用于数据分析、人工智能、网站开发等领域。
⚠️ 温馨提示:本教程以 Windows系统 + VS Code编辑器 + Python3.10+ 为例,Mac 和 Linux 用户也能参考大部分内容。
Step 1: 安装 Python 解释器
- 打开浏览器,访问 https://www.python.org/downloads/
- 下载适合你系统的最新版本(推荐至少 Python 3.10)
- 双击下载好的安装包 → 勾选 “Add to PATH” → 点击 “Install Now”
- 安装完成后,在命令行输入:
python --version
如果看到类似 Python 3.10.6 的输出,说明安装成功!
Step 2: 安装 VS Code 编辑器
VS Code 是微软推出的一款轻量级但功能强大的代码编辑器,非常适合编程新手。
- 打开官网:https://code.visualstudio.com/download
- 下载并安装对应系统的版本。
- 启动软件后,你会看到一个清爽的界面。
Step 3: 配置 VS Code 插件(用于 Python)
为了更好的开发体验,我们需要添加一些插件:
- 在 VS Code 左侧点击 Extensions 图标(或按
Ctrl+Shift+X) - 搜索并安装以下插件:
- Python(官方插件)
- Pylance(智能补全)
- Jupyter(如果你要学数据分析)
- 安装完成后,在 VS Code 中打开任意
.py文件,会自动识别 Python 解释器路径。
Step 4: 创建你的第一个项目文件夹
创建一个专属于练习的目录,例如:
C:\Users\你的名字\Desktop\my_first_project
在 VS Code 中:
- 点击菜单栏“文件” → “打开文件夹” → 找到上述目录 → 打开
- 右键点击空白区域,选择“新建文件”,命名为
hello.py
现在你可以在这个文件中写下第一行代码了:
print("Hello, world!")
按下 F5 或点击左上方的 ▶️ 按钮运行程序,你应该在终端看到输出:
Hello, world!
恭喜你完成了开发环境的第一步搭建!
第二步:核心概念讲解 —— 理解开发工具背后的原理

在继续实战前,我们先了解几个关键概念,它们将帮助你更好地理解和优化你的开发流程。
1. 什么是解释器?
🧑🏫 类比:就像翻译官帮你听懂外语一样,解释器的作用是把你写的代码变成电脑能理解并执行的指令。
不同编程语言有不同的解释器。比如 Python 就有 CPython、PyPy 等实现。
我们在前面安装的是 CPython,这是官方标准解释器。
2. 什么是虚拟环境(Virtual Environment)?
🧑🏫 类比:想象你在做菜时,不想让不同项目的食材混在一起。虚拟环境就是为每一个项目单独准备一套独立的“烹饪工具和调料”。
这样做的好处是:
- 不同项目之间不会互相干扰(比如一个项目需要 Python 3.8,另一个需要 3.10)
- 便于管理依赖包(后面讲)
如何创建虚拟环境?
在你的项目文件夹下,运行命令:
python -m venv venv
然后在 VS Code 中选择这个解释器路径:
venv\Scripts\python.exe
3. 什么是 IDE?
IDE = Integrated Development Environment,中文叫集成开发环境。
VS Code 就是一款 IDE,它集成了代码编辑器、调试器、终端等多个功能。
它的优点包括:
- 代码自动补全
- 实时语法检查
- 错误高亮提示
- 插件扩展性强
4. 什么是包管理器?
每个项目可能都需要一些额外的功能模块,比如处理时间、绘图、连接数据库等。
这些模块被称为“包(Packages)”,而管理这些包的工具就叫做“包管理器”。
Python 的包管理器叫 pip。
示例:安装一个包
比如我们要画图,可以安装 matplotlib:
pip install matplotlib
之后就可以在代码中导入它:
import matplotlib.pyplot as plt
plt.plot([1,2,3], [4,5,1])
plt.show()
第三步:实战项目 —— 制作一个“每日提醒记事本”

我们来做一个小应用,帮助你巩固开发环境操作技能。
功能描述:
- 用户可以在终端输入今天的待办事项
- 系统记录下来,保存到一个
.txt文件中 - 第二次启动程序时,显示昨天的内容作为提醒
Step 1: 创建项目目录
在你的工作区新建一个文件夹:
daily_reminder/
并创建两个文件:
main.py
notes.txt
Step 2: 编写核心逻辑
编辑 main.py:
import os
from datetime import datetime
NOTE_FILE = 'notes.txt'
def read_notes():
if not os.path.exists(NOTE_FILE):
return ""
with open(NOTE_FILE, 'r', encoding='utf-8') as f:
return f.read()
def write_note(new_content):
with open(NOTE_FILE, 'w', encoding='utf-8') as f:
f.write(new_content)
def main():
print("=== 每日提醒记事本 ===")
old_notes = read_notes()
if old_notes:
print("上次的提醒内容:")
print(old_notes)
new_input = input("\n请输入今天要做的事:\n")
current_time = datetime.now().strftime("%Y-%m-%d %H:%M:%S")
full_note = f"{current_time}\n{new_input}\n{'-'*20}\n"
final_note = old_notes + full_note
write_note(final_note)
print("\n✅ 提醒已保存!")
if __name__ == '__main__':
main()
Step 3: 运行程序
回到终端,进入项目目录后执行:
python main.py
按照提示操作几次,你会发现 notes.txt 文件中自动记录下了每天的备忘。
Step 4: 使用 VS Code 优化开发体验
现在我们可以尝试以下几个优化操作:
- 启用自动补全:在设置中搜索“IntelliSense”,确保开启
- 开启实时检查错误:安装 Python 插件后默认已启用
- 使用多窗口编辑:你可以同时打开多个
.py文件 - 调试运行:点击 VS Code 调试图标,尝试一步步查看变量变化
第四步:常见问题解答(FAQ)
❓ Q1:为什么运行程序时报错“No module named ‘xxx’”?
这是一个常见的错误,意思是找不到某个你需要使用的模块/包。
▶️ 解决方法:
- 检查是否拼写正确
- 确认是否已经使用 pip 安装该包:如
pip install xxx - 查看当前使用的解释器是否是你创建的虚拟环境
❓ Q2:VS Code 提示“Python interpreter not found”怎么办?
这意味着你还没有告诉 VS Code 使用哪个 Python 解释器。
▶️ 解决方法:
- 点击左下方那个 Python 字样(如:“Python 3.10.6”)
- 弹出菜单里选择你安装的 Python 版本
❓ Q3:我写完的代码总是报语法错误怎么办?
可能是空格缩进不一致、少了括号、逗号等问题导致。
▶️ 建议:
- 多看看红色波浪线提示的位置
- 使用格式化快捷键(Alt + Shift + F)自动对齐代码
- 初学者可使用在线检查工具辅助排查语法
第五步:学习建议 —— 接下来你该怎么学?
恭喜你走到了这一步!你现在有了一个基本可用的开发环境,而且完成了一个小型项目。接下来的学习方向如下:
🧪 进阶主题建议:
- Git版本控制:学习如何保存和恢复代码的不同版本
- 自动化测试与持续集成:让你的程序自己测试自己
- Docker容器化:一键打包你的程序及其环境
- 云开发平台使用:如 GitHub Codespaces、Replit
💡 练习建议:
- 每周写一个小项目(如计算器、天气查询等)
- 练习使用 Git 管理代码(可以试试 GitHub 免费仓库)
- 多参与开源社区讨论(如 Stack Overflow、知乎、掘金)
结语:你已经迈出成为程序员的重要第一步!

开发环境不是一次性的工具,而是你不断打磨、适应自己习惯的过程。通过本教程,你已经掌握了:
- 安装 Python 并配置环境
- 使用 VS Code 提高效率
- 理解虚拟环境和包管理
- 完成一个完整的项目实战
- 解决常见初学问题的方法
记住一句话:
编程不是魔法,只是不断解决问题的艺术。而好的开发环境,就是你最得力的助手。
继续保持热情,继续敲代码,你也可以成为优秀的开发者!
✍️ 作者:开发工具入门讲师 · 编程星球
📅 更新时间:2025年4月5日
📍 适用人群:零基础编程爱好者、学生、自学开发者
如有技术细节更新或勘误,请关注本站持续更新内容。

评论 0